Know Your Needs<\/h3>\n<p>First off, you gotta figure out what you need the lobby kiosk for. Are you using it for wayfinding in a big building? Maybe it&#8217;s for information sharing in a hospital or a school. Or perhaps you want to use it for ticketing in a theater or a transportation hub.<\/p>\n<p>If it&#8217;s for wayfinding, you&#8217;ll need a kiosk with a detailed map and an easy &#8211; to &#8211; use interface. You need to be able to update the map easily as well, in case there are any changes in the building layout. For example, if you&#8217;re setting it up in a corporate office, new departments might move around, so you have to modify the directions.<\/p>\n<p>For information sharing, it should be able to display various types of content, like images, videos, and text. In a hospital, it could show details about different departments, doctors&#8217; schedules, and health tips. So, you need a kiosk with a large, high &#8211; resolution screen and enough storage and processing power to handle all that media.<\/p>\n<p>When it comes to ticketing, you&#8217;ll need a kiosk that can handle payments securely. It should be connected to a reliable payment gateway and have a printer to issue tickets.<\/p>\n<h3>2. Consider the Location<\/h3>\n<p>The location where you&#8217;ll place the kiosk is super important. If it&#8217;s in a high &#8211; traffic area, like a shopping mall or an airport, it needs to be durable. You don&#8217;t want it to break down easily from all the usage. Look for kiosks with a sturdy construction, maybe made of stainless steel or high &#8211; grade plastic.<\/p>\n<p>On the other hand, if it&#8217;s in a more private setting, like a small office lobby, you might focus more on the aesthetics. You can choose a sleek, modern &#8211; looking kiosk that fits well with the office decor.<\/p>\n<p>Also, think about the lighting in the area. If it&#8217;s in a well &#8211; lit place, a regular screen might work fine. But if it&#8217;s in a dimly lit area, you&#8217;ll want a kiosk with a backlit screen so people can easily see the information.<\/p>\n<h3>3. Look at the Screen<\/h3>\n<p>The screen is one of the most crucial parts of a lobby kiosk. First, consider the size. A larger screen is generally better, especially if you&#8217;re displaying a lot of information. For wayfinding or information sharing, a 22 &#8211; inch or larger screen can make it easier for people to view the details.<\/p>\n<p>The resolution is also key. You want a high &#8211; resolution screen to ensure the text and images are sharp and clear. A 1920&#215;1080 resolution or higher is a good choice.<\/p>\n<p>Touchscreen functionality is almost a must these days. It makes the user experience more interactive and intuitive. Make sure the touchscreen is responsive and accurate. You don&#8217;t want people to have to tap the screen multiple times just to select an option.<\/p>\n<h3>4. Evaluate the Software<\/h3>\n<p>The software running on the kiosk is what makes it useful. It should be user &#8211; friendly. People of all ages and technical abilities should be able to use it without much trouble. The interface should be simple, with clear icons and instructions.<\/p>\n<p>It also needs to be customizable. You might want to change the content, add new features, or modify the layout from time to time. So, look for a kiosk with software that allows for easy customization.<\/p>\n<p>Security is another big deal. The software should protect your data and prevent unauthorized access. It should be regularly updated to patch any security holes.<\/p>\n<h3>5. Check the Connectivity<\/h3>\n<p>Connectivity options are important for keeping your kiosk up &#8211; to &#8211; date and functional. Wi &#8211; Fi is a must in most cases. It allows you to easily update the content on the kiosk and connect it to other devices or systems.<\/p>\n<p>Ethernet is also a good option, especially if you want a more stable and fast connection. It&#8217;s great for high &#8211; traffic areas where a large amount of data needs to be transferred quickly, like in a busy airport or a convention center.<\/p>\n<p>Some kiosks also support Bluetooth, which can be useful for things like connecting to mobile devices or printing wirelessly.<\/p>\n<h3>6. Think About Maintenance and Support<\/h3>\n<p>You don&#8217;t want to be stuck with a kiosk that&#8217;s hard to maintain. Look for a kiosk that&#8217;s easy to open up and access the internal components. This makes it simpler to replace parts if something goes wrong.<\/p>\n<p>The supplier should offer good support. That means having a team that can answer your questions quickly, whether it&#8217;s about getting the kiosk set up, troubleshooting an issue, or providing software updates.<\/p>\n<p>It&#8217;s also a good idea to ask about the warranty. A longer warranty period gives you more peace of mind.<\/p>\n<h3>7. Compare the Costs<\/h3>\n<p>Cost is always a factor. You need to find a balance between getting a good &#8211; quality kiosk and staying within your budget.<\/p>\n<p>When you&#8217;re comparing prices, don&#8217;t just look at the upfront cost. Consider the long &#8211; term costs as well, like maintenance, software updates, and power consumption.<\/p>\n<p>Some suppliers might offer a package deal that includes installation, training, and support. This can be a good option as it saves you the hassle of dealing with multiple vendors.<\/p>\n<h3>8. Read Reviews and Get References<\/h3>\n<p>Before making a decision, take the time to read reviews from other customers. You can find these online on business review websites, industry forums, or even on the supplier&#8217;s own website.<\/p>\n<p>Ask the supplier for references. Talk to other businesses that have used their kiosks. They can give you first &#8211; hand information about the performance, reliability, and customer support of the kiosk.<\/p>\n<h3>9. Test the Kiosk if Possible<\/h3>\n<p>If the supplier allows it, try to test the kiosk before you buy it. This gives you a chance to see how it works in real &#8211; life situations. You can check the touchscreen responsiveness, the clarity of the screen, and the ease of use of the software.<\/p>\n<p>You can also test any specific features that are important to you, like payment processing or wayfinding functionality.<\/p>\n<p>In conclusion, choosing the right lobby kiosk takes some time and research.
